When searching for the and companion Boardview (.CAD or .BRD) files, ensure you look for matching revision codes. A schematic meant for Rev 1.0 may have minor component designation differences (e.g., PR102 vs. PR105), which can lead to mistakes during micro-soldering.

If all voltages are correct but the board fails to POST, check pin 8 of the BIOS IC for +3V . If voltage is present, the SPI data lines may be corrupt. Reflashing the BIOS with a verified working dump file for the LA-E791P Rev 2.0 is highly recommended.
